嘿,开发者们!
让我们来谈谈数据库领域的强者:MySQL。无论您是构建小型个人项目还是大型企业应用程序,MySQL 都可以成为您高效管理数据的首选解决方案。所以,拿起你最喜欢的非酒精饮料(因为酒精不适合编码,而且可能会让你想起你的前任),放松一下,让我们深入了解 MySQL 的全部内容以及它如何增强你的开发过程!
什么是 MySQL?
MySQL 是一种开源关系数据库管理系统 (RDBMS),它使用结构化查询语言 (SQL) 来访问和管理数据。它以其可靠性、稳健性和易用性而闻名,使其成为世界上最受欢迎的数据库之一。以下是其主要功能的快速概述:
性能:读写操作的高速性能。
可扩展性:轻松从小型应用程序扩展到拥有数百万条记录的大型数据库。
安全性:具有加密、身份验证和授权功能的强大数据保护。
社区和支持:广泛的文档、活跃的社区和商业支持选项。
MySQL 入门
设置和使用 MySQL 非常简单。这是帮助您入门的快速指南:
1)安装MySQL:
您可以从官方网站下载并安装MySQL。
按照特定于您的操作系统的安装说明进行操作。
2)设置MySQL服务器:
安装完成后,启动MySQL服务器。
通过设置 root 密码并使用以下方法删除匿名用户和测试数据库来保护您的安装:
mysql_secure_installation
3)访问MySQL:
mysql -u root -p
4)创建数据库和表:
CREATE DATABASE my_database;
USE my_database;
CREATE TABLE users 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(100), email VARCHAR(100) );
5)插入数据:
INSERT INTO users (name, email) VALUES ('Shafayet Hossain', 'shafayeat.me@example.com');
6)查询数据:
SELECT * FROM users;
MySQL 与 SQL:有什么区别?
虽然 MySQL 和 SQL 密切相关,但它们并不是一回事。以下是差异的快速细分:
SQL(结构化查询语言)-
它是什么:用于查询和管理关系数据库的标准化语言。
用途:提供一种与数据库通信和操作数据库的方法。
用例:诸如 SELECT、INSERT、UPDATE 和 DELETE 之类的 SQL 命令可在各种数据库系统中使用。
为什么你会喜欢 MySQL
MySQL 提供了强大功能和简单性的平衡,使其成为开发人员的最爱。这就是您会喜欢它的原因:
用户友好:易于设置和使用,提供大量教程和资源。
灵活性:支持从 Web 开发到数据仓库的广泛应用程序。
可靠性:生产环境中稳定性和可靠性的良好记录。
开源:免费使用和修改,充满活力的社区为其不断改进做出贡献。
最后的想法
MySQL 是一个多功能且功能强大的数据库解决方案,可以处理各种数据管理需求。无论您是刚刚起步还是希望优化现有的数据库设置,MySQL 都可以提供帮助您取得成功的工具和功能。深入研究、实验并了解 MySQL 如何增强您的开发项目。
继续分享您的 MySQL 想法或直接提问,因为我们非常重视您的意见!
以上是关于 MySQL 的一切的详细内容。更多信息请关注PHP中文网其他相关文章!